Types of Floor Moulding for American Homes

Choosing the right floor moulding enhances room transitions, protects walls, and adds architectural character. This guide covers common floor moulding types used in U.S. homes, including baseboards, reducers, and decorative profiles. It explains where each type shines, material options, and practical installation tips to help homeowners and builders make informed decisions.

Overview Of Floor Moulding Categories

Floor moulding serves both functional and decorative roles. It protects wall edges from scuffs, covers gaps between walls and floors, and creates a finished look. Moulding varies in profile, height, material, and installation method. In residential projects, baseboards and shoe moulding are the most frequent choices, while specialty profiles add architectural interest in living spaces and hallways.

Baseboards

Baseboards run along the bottom edge of walls where they meet the floor. They hide gaps, protect walls from furniture, and provide a clean transition. Common heights range from 3 to 6 inches, though taller profiles are popular in formal spaces. Materials include wood, medium-density fiberboard (MDF), PUR foam, PVC, and composite blends. Finishes vary from stained wood to painted white. Installation typically uses nails or adhesive, with caulk sealing gaps at corners.

Wood And Composite Baseboards

Wood baseboards offer warmth and durability but can be pricier and may require staining. MDF and composite baseboards are budget-friendly, easy to paint, and stable in humid environments. For bathrooms or basements, moisture-resistant PVC or composite options help prevent warping.

Detail And Style Variations

Baseboard profiles range from simple squared edges to molded capitals and bead details. Architectural styles such as Craftsman, traditional, or modern depend on profile depth and curvature. When pairing with crown moulding, ensure scale balance between ceiling height and wall length.

Quarter Round And Shoe Molding

Quarter round and shoe moulding provide a subtle finish at the intersection of wall and floor, covering expansion gaps and nail holes. These profiles are thin, cost-effective, and easy to install with nails or adhesive. Quarter round is a quarter-circle profile, while shoe molding has a flatter, more angular look.

Applications And Material Options

They are versatile in living rooms, kitchens, and hallways where a minimal seam is desired. Materials include wood, MDF, and PVC. PVC options are favored in moisture-prone areas or basements due to water resistance and easy maintenance.

Cove Molding And Decorative Pipe

Cove molding features a concave profile that adds soft, understated depth to transitions. It is often used where a subtle, shadowed edge is desired, such as in dining rooms or entryways. Decorative pipe or screen edging provides more elaborate curvature for distinctive architectural accents. Both can be painted or stained to match trim schemes.

Choosing Profiles For Rooms

In smaller rooms with lower ceilings, choose shallower coves to avoid crowding walls. In larger spaces, deeper coves create a sense of scale and elegance. Materials include wood, MDF, and polyurethane, with polyurethane offering lightweight, durable performance and good resistance to dents.

Thresholds And Door Jamb Transitions

Door thresholds and floor transitions use moulding to manage height changes between rooms and between flooring types (e.g., hardwood to tile). Thresholds protect edges and provide a clean visual break. Common materials mirror baseboard selections, with aluminum or metal thresholds used for high-traffic or commercial-grade installations.

Flat Vs. Angled Transitions

Flat transitions suit level floor changes, while beveled or rounded thresholds accommodate slight height differences. Proper installation minimizes tripping hazards and ensures smooth rolling for furniture and appliances.

Stair Nosing And Stair Moulding

Stair nosing edges protect stair treads and improve traction. Stair moulding also adds a finished look to stair risers and stringers. Materials include hardwood, oak, maple, MDF, and PVC. Finishes should complement adjacent baseboards and trim to maintain visual coherence.

Practical Considerations

Choose thicker nosing in high-traffic stairways and consider anti-slip profiles for safety. For renovations, ensure stair moulding aligns with existing flooring heights and underlayment to prevent gaps.

Material Options And Performance

Material choice affects cost, durability, moisture resistance, and finish appearance. Typical options include wood (oak, pine, maple), MDF, PVC, and PUR foam. Wood provides timeless warmth and easy staining but can warp with moisture. MDF offers smooth paint-ready surfaces at a lower cost but is less durable in damp spaces. PVC and PUR are moisture-resistant and lightweight, suitable for bathrooms and basements.

Moisture And Environment

In kitchens, bathrooms, and basements, select moisture-resistant materials. PVC or PUR mouldings resist humidity and water exposure better than natural wood. In living areas, wood or MDF with proper sealing yields the best finish and longevity when moisture is not a major concern.

Installation Tips And Aftercare

Proper installation ensures a seamless appearance and long-lasting performance. Tools typically include a miter saw, nail gun or finish nails, wood glue, caulk, and a level. Steps involve measuring room perimeter, cutting profiles at precise angles, nailing into wall studs or studs near corners, filling nail holes, caulking gaps, and painting or staining after the adhesive cures. Finish nails are preferred for baseboards to prevent flush appearance issues.

Finishing And Maintenance

Paint or stain evenly, applying primer if needed. Regular cleaning with a soft cloth prevents dust buildup. Inspect for gaps or cracking and reseal as necessary after seasons of humidity or temperature changes. For PVC or PUR mouldings, use compatible cleaners to avoid surface damage.

Practical Guide To Selecting Floor Moulding

Selecting the right floor moulding involves room size, ceiling height, flooring type, and architectural style. For open rooms with higher ceilings, taller baseboards or decorative coves can elevate the space. In small rooms, slender profiles create balance without overpowering walls. Consider color and finish consistency with wall paint, trim, and flooring to achieve a cohesive look.

Common Mistakes To Avoid

  • Choosing overly tall baseboards for low-ceiling rooms, which can overwhelm space.
  • Ignoring expansion gaps, leading to warping or cracks after seasonal changes.
  • Using incompatible materials in moisture-prone areas.
  • Inconsistent nail placement or poor seam alignment, resulting in visible gaps.
